#88ced1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#88ced1 is composed of 53.3% red, 80.8%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.9% cyan, 1.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 182.5 degrees, a saturation of 44.2% and a lightness of 67.6%. #88ced1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#119da3.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#88ced1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030808 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#88ced1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8b1b1 is the less saturated color, while #5cf7fd is the most saturated one.
